PySpur-Dev pyspur Jinja2 Template single_llm_call.py SingleLLMCallNode special elements used in a template engine

Description

A vulnerability was found in PySpur-Dev pyspur up to 0.1.18. It has been classified as critical. Affected is the function SingleLLMCallNode of the file backend/pyspur/nodes/llm/single_llm_call.py of the component Jinja2 Template Handler. The manipulation of the argument user_message leads to improper neutralization of special elements used in a template engine. It is possible to launch the attack remotely. The exploit has been disclosed to the public and may be used.
